Custom designed sets (with instructions) by Shoji Kawamori (Macross mech designer):

http://www.brickshelf.com/cgi-bin/gallery.cgi?f=161353

http://www.brickshelf.com/cgi-bin/gallery.cgi?f=224448

From wikipedia:

In 2006, Lego commissioned Shoji Kawamori to design combination models using various Exo-Force sets. The combo-units were called VAN-Force; they featured custom decals, which were given away with purchase of bundled Exo-Force sets in Japan. The first VAN-Force design used the Stealth Hunter and Grand Titan. A second combination design called "Raiden" (which uses the Stealth Hunter, Grand Titan, and Thunder Fury) was revealed in December 2006. In Kawamori's Macross fashion, the units can transform between from robot to vehicle. According to Exo-Force writer, Greg Farshtey, Lego does not have the rights to reproduce the VAN-Force design for sale in stores.

Instructions for those 2 mechs are listed on the page - click on the numbered thumbnails for instructions. If you are after additional parts, I recommend bricklink.com for all your parts needs. Its like ebay but for Lego. It has an inventory guide for every set produced so if you are missing parts from a set, you can obtain them easily and cheaply. I've ordered parts for complete sets and they ended up cheaper than buying the sets themselves!! Plus you can obtain rare parts which the Legoshop might not have. :cool:
